For switching to TSB (now done) I set up a Plum direct debit with the donor account. But in the past few days I received a couple of messages about them losing the connection, which I ignored as I was under the impression that didn't affect the DD. Now they have emailed me to say they have cancelled the DD. It's still showing in TSB though. How much of a problem is this for the switch? Can Plum cancelling the direct debit with the previous bank filter through somehow and get it cancelled with TSB? I didn't think the TSB DD's actually needed to be paying out, just active, so is it safe to ignore this? Would a new link from Plum to TSB be a good idea, maybe with a different DD amount, or maybe a bad idea?

The switch already completed. I set up PayPal and Plum on the donor account, and they both paid out and showed as Active. Then I completed the switch. After which both showed as Active on the new TSB account. So far so good. But now Plum has cancelled their DD their end apparently. The TSB T&C's state that by 24th March I need to have 2+ Direct Debits. And for the extra £75 between 01.04.2023 and 31.10.2023 I need to have 2+ Direct Debits. So is this "cancelled" Plum direct debit going to disappear from TSB now and mess things up? Or will it carry on showing up as Active? I don't know that much about DD's.0
-
Well, now the Plum Direct Debit has disappeared from the TSB account. And Plum is refusing to link to TSB as a main account, claiming it's a "credit card, savings or business account" or "has an unsupported currency". Marvellous!
My advice is don't use Plum to fulfil DD requirements.0 -
Final update. Trying again in the light of day and the fresh link to TSB worked ok when done via the app. The Plum app opened a web page for TSB which had an option to open in the TSB app which I didn't see at first (small and at the bottom and only flashed up for a moment) and doing that made a working link which immediately also set up a new DD without me doing anything. It should show up before Friday 24th March. Maybe that's of help to somebody.1
